Output d6e68e9541c30104e7d42cb41007e0f8cc86628873d16a83443ea0f4f8cf46b5:3

value
438697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54dc953f39f3988b436bff13cd386ba455fd6c37 OP_EQUAL
address
39Riw2rTjtK9U3PVf8VaZLmCVAgv9f3kV7
transaction
d6e68e9541c30104e7d42cb41007e0f8cc86628873d16a83443ea0f4f8cf46b5
spent
true